How Do Erosion Control Blankets Work. Erosion control blankets effectively reduce soil loss by protecting the ground from wind, rain, and other external forces. Erosion control blankets work by providing a protective layer that shields the soil from the erosive forces of water and wind. Blankets create a favorable environment for vegetation growth, helping to reestablish natural vegetation and maintain a stable ecosystem. An erosion control blanket is a blanket of synthetic or natural fibers to protect soil from the erosive impact of rain and water flow, typically on slopes and in channels. Erosion control blankets are also called erosion control mats depending on their specific purposes and materials. What are erosion control blankets?
